Kilambe: It’s time to reclaim COSAFA Cup glory

Share

Former Chipolopolo striker Rotson Kilambe says time has come for Zambia to reclaim the COSAFA Senior Challenge Cup.

Zambia last won the COSAFA Cup in 2013 on home soil.

This year’s COSAFA Cup will be staged in the South African coastal city of Durban from May 25 to June 8.

“This time we must win the COSAFA Cup. It is been long since we won the COSAFA Cup,” Kilambe said.

Zambia has finished runners up at the last two editions.

“Players should know that when they are selected for such tournament they are going to represent the nation. They should work hard to bring good results,” Kilambe added.

Kilambe himself is a COSAFA Cup legend.

He won Man of the Match in his debut in the COSAFA Cup in a 1-0 win over Malawi in 1998, and later grabbed the goal that took Chipolopolo to the trophy win that year against Zimbabwe.

Kilambe turned out for South African giants Kaizer Chiefs and Mamelodi Sundowns, as well as Bloemfontein Celtic, with who he won the top eight competitions.
